Log in scroll down to the bottom - almost everything apart from sales items are in the bottom menu.
  [ You are not allowed to view attachments ]  
Client attention (support)
Scroll
Need more help? - contact us
  [ You are not allowed to view attachments ]  
Choose item and then "Cuéntanos más" select an option.. and help in English
  [ You are not allowed to view attachments ]  
Then you have the option to phone, email or chat
